Philadelphia, US: Democrats began a four-day meeting in Philadelphia on Monday that will end with the presidential nomination of Hillary Clinton, the first female to lead a major US political party’s White House ticket.
Baltimore mayor Stephanie Rawlings-Blake stepped in to formally open the proceedings, after party boss Debbie Wasserman Schultz was ousted in a feud that has split the party as it heads toward November’s election.
